Seaman Killed by Mooring Lines

December 29, 2009

According to a report from www.silive.com, a deckhand at the Moran Towing Corp. dock in Port Richmond, was crushed to death on board one of the company's tugboats in Hackensack River near Secaucus, N.J., at 2:00 a.m. the morning of Dec. 27. Ricardo Young, 50, of Queens, died on board the Turecamo Girls when he became tangled in hawsers being used to tow another vessel.
